This was made originally for my god-daughter's 21st birthday - I thought the Eiffel Tower was quite appropriate as she was spending a few days in Paris with her fiance. I changed my mind at the last minute (as you do with cards for important people!) and made an alternative. Needless to say, I never got a photo of that one as the glue was still drying when she opened the envelope ;)

The red cardbase has been stamped using black ink and the En Francais background stamp, then a layer of designer paper (with distressed and charcoal-inked edges) added to the left hand side. The tower has been stamped in black on vanilla cardstock, which has then been crumpled and the edges distressed using the fabulous distressing kit. A layer of black cardstock provides a mat for the image. The sentiment has been stamped in black then punched and coloured using a red marker, then popped up on dimensionals.

Products used (all Stampin' Up!):

  • Stamps – Artistic Etchings, Oval All, En Francais BG
  • Ink – Basic Black, Charcoal
  • Cardstock – Red Riding Hood Red, Basic Black , Very Vanilla
  • Other – Love Letter DSP, Marvellous Markers, 1¾ Oval punch, Distressing kit, sponge daubers, dimensionals.
